 In terms of this Trac ticket:

 **The issue:**
 Paginated pages with no entries display the original post.
 Here is an example: https://wordpress.org/support/topic/wordpress-
 infinite-link-problem/page/12345/

 **The proposed solution:**
 When a permalink is evaluated for a paginated URL, it should check if the
 particular page "exists" (contains entries).
 If not, the visitor should be redirected to the original post's URL.
